A branded Facebook Page for Conversationblog

Facebook pages for corporate use have been around for a while but not many organisations "brand" them and use the latest update.

A few days ago I was reading up on several articles with regards to branded Facebook pages and found an easy to use online service to create one for Conversationblog.com

Pagemodo is a tool to create your own branded Facebook page offering a nice way to create a welcome page which gives an overview of your services and/or product.

You can add your own photos, embed video, change the fonts and text and show your products in a whole new light. (Pagemodo)

They have several pre-made templates you can use and edit. Inserting links to your website, blog or any specific web page is very easy and the customisation options are many.

I used the free account which gives me just 1 page but their are several option ranging from 9$/month to 59$/month. The last option gives you 15 active pages, video, live support and no Pagemodo branding.

This is a great way, not only to market you company or agency but also to build much more interactivity and content into Facebook.
